Transaction 2628028c0780b8f3f66b872ca3de6b134db3265ecd45385b5b4c59d1d281ceeb

block
3a69a717057a76b46f7579713aa833f8c2c6be7baa7151d5cf35b1676e5dcb96

1 Input

24 Outputs